Fabrics play a central role in defining the personality of gothic outerwear. Velvet coats exude richness and romance, while leather jackets embody toughness and rebellion. Wool and heavy cotton blends provide warmth and structure, making them ideal for winter wardrobes, while lighter materials such as lace overlays or sheer mesh capes add drama without weight. Many gothic outerwear designs incorporate details like metal buckles, chains, straps, and embroidery, turning functional garments into works of art. Dark tones dominate-black, charcoal, deep burgundy, and midnight blue-but metallic accents and contrasting textures add striking layers of detail.

Historically, gothic outerwear has roots in both gothic subculture and fashion history. Long coats and capes were staples of Victorian and medieval attire, later reimagined in the 1980s when gothic rock popularized dramatic black trench coats and leather jackets. In the 1990s and 2000s, gothic outerwear expanded with industrial and cyber influences, adding straps, buckles, and oversized hoods to the designs. Today, it continues to evolve, blending these historical elements with contemporary cuts and streetwear-inspired features.
